This chapter explores Kanye West's criticism of the Bush administration during a Hurricane Katrina telethon and its impact on media representation of Black individuals. It captures the collective frustration of the Black community regarding media portrayals in the wake of the disaster, emphasizing the significance of West's dissenting voice.
